OKI pro510DW Digital Web Color Printer
The new OKI proColor™ pro510DW digital color web press prints continuous-fed media or cut sheets, up to 12.9" widths, on industry-standard converted or non- converted face stocks, paper, synthetic and adhesive-backed substrates. With sequential or variable data personalization. All in brilliant, durable, consistent color.

Roland LEC-330 UV Inkjet Printer/Cutter
Designed for a host of short-run production, packaging prototyping and proofing applications, the Roland VersaUV LEC-330 Inkjet Printer/Cut- ter can significantly lower pre-press costs, save time and generate new revenues for commercial printers, packaging designers and others. With a maximum printing/cutting width of 29” and its ability to print up to 101 sqft./hr and on a variety of materials the LEC-330 is a versatile pre-press and proofing device that can save commercial printers the many costs associated with press downtime.

The AVflex 8100 combination exposure, washout, dryer, and detack unit has been specifically engineered for high quality platemaking applications up to 25” x 30”. Two-brush rotary washout provides efficient plate processing. Washout operations are controlled by a SmartPanel processor. Features include automatic drum position- ing with forward and reverse job for easy removal of plates.

Extends Plate Life

The PlateWasher is a low maintenance unit designed to clean inks from any size plate up to 110” or 66” wide. The machine is easy to load and easy to operate. A gentle brushing action removes ink with a cleaning solution, and a dual-tank supply system allows for reuse of the washout solution.

AVCE direct engraving material is specifically designed for state-of-the-art laser engraving systems, like those manufac- tured by Stork Prints. Processing plates and sleeves digitally eliminate the need for film processing, exposing, traditional solvent wash and long drying times. Added benefits include better quality reproduction over longer runs, simple change- over, reduced errors, fast turnaround, more economical and
more environmentally-friendly plate production.
